In dentistry, calculus is a form of hardened dental plaque, caused by precipitation of calcium (Ca) and phosphorous (P) ions deposited from saliva and gingival crevicular fluid. Although the dental biofilm cannot be eliminated, it can be controlled with comprehensive mechanical and chemotherapeutic oral hygiene practices. Chemotherapeutic agents have difficulty penetrating the polysaccharide matrix to reach and affect the microorganisms. The purpose of the present study was to evaluate the anti-calculus efficiency of a mouthwash containing an association of sodium tripolyphosphate, tetrapotassium pyrophosphate, sodium bicarbonate and citric acid in patients affected with gingivitis.
